Planning for the Chardham Yatra in Uttarakhand is a spiritual journey that requires meticulous preparation to ensure a smooth and fulfilling experience. The Chardham Yatra comprises four sacred sites - Yamunotri, Gangotri, Kedarnath, and Badrinath - each holding significant religious importance for Hindus. Here's a comprehensive guide on how to plan for the Chardham Yatra in Uttarakhand:

Research and Information Gathering

Before embarking on the Chardham Yatra, gather detailed information about the pilgrimage, including the significance of each site, the best time to visit, and the weather conditions. Utilize online resources, travel guides, and consult with experienced travelers to get insights into the journey.

Fixed Itinerary and Route Planning

Create a fixed itinerary that includes the sequence of visiting each of the Chardham destinations. The traditional sequence is Yamunotri, Gangotri, Kedarnath, and Badrinath. Plan the duration of stay at each destination, considering factors like travel time, darshan timings, and any rest days needed for acclimatization.

Identify the route you will be taking, whether by road or helicopter, and plan transportation accordingly. Be mindful of road conditions, especially in high-altitude areas, and factor in travel time between the destinations.

Accommodation and Booking

Book accommodation well in advance, especially during peak pilgrimage seasons. Options range from budget hotels to Dharamshalas and guesthouses. Ensure that your chosen accommodation is close to the temples for easy access to the religious sites.

Consider the availability of basic amenities like hot water, cleanliness, and proximity to local markets. Make reservations online or through reliable travel agencies.

Transportation Planning

Decide on the mode of transportation based on your preferences and budget. Options include private vehicles, shared cabs, or government-operated buses. If opting for a road journey, check the condition of the vehicles and drivers' experience in mountainous terrains.

For those with time constraints or physical limitations, helicopter services are available for a quicker and more convenient journey between the Chardham destinations.

Health and Fitness Preparation

Given the high altitude of Chardham sites, it's crucial to be physically prepared for the journey. Consult with a healthcare professional before the trip, especially if you have any pre-existing health conditions. Carry essential medications and a basic first aid kit.

Practice light exercises and yoga to improve stamina and acclimatize your body to the altitude. Stay hydrated and avoid excessive physical exertion, especially in higher altitudes.

Weather and Packing Essentials

Check the weather conditions during the planned travel period. Pack accordingly with warm clothing, rain gear, comfortable trekking shoes, and other essentials. Include items like sunscreen, sunglasses, and a hat for protection against the sun's rays.

Carry a sturdy backpack with sufficient water, energy bars, and a small portable medical kit during your visits to the temples.

Spiritual Preparedness and Cultural Sensitivity

Prepare yourself spiritually for the Chardham Yatra by understanding the cultural and religious significance of each site. Respect local customs, traditions, and the sanctity of the pilgrimage.

Adopt a humble and patient approach during temple visits. Follow the guidelines provided by the authorities, and maintain a serene and contemplative demeanor.

Safety Measures and Emergency Preparedness

Prioritize safety by informing family and friends about your travel plans. Carry identification documents, emergency contact details, and a list of essential contacts.

Stay updated on weather forecasts and road conditions. Be aware of emergency services, medical facilities, and helpline numbers along the route.

Budgeting and Financial Planning

Create a detailed budget covering transportation, accommodation, meals, permits, and miscellaneous expenses. Carry sufficient cash, as ATM facilities may be limited in certain remote areas.

Keep some extra funds for unforeseen circumstances and emergencies. It's advisable to have a mix of cash and digital payment options for convenience.
